Output b376fa2108145d4ba9f50d82b7d1d70b35a58a8b2db9bd278d2898d39d889ce8:1

value
1556382443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c95ee21f86b45d2e8715ef4983e549fe956d8ae6 OP_EQUAL
address
3L3mQi3afHCPgy4LdZje7iN29PpUFRwxzk
transaction
b376fa2108145d4ba9f50d82b7d1d70b35a58a8b2db9bd278d2898d39d889ce8
spent
true